One thing about New York City that nearly everyone likes is the food.

The Big Apple has some big pizza, subs, fine dining and many other places to satisfy your hunger. If you’re a Major League Baseball star like East Carolina alum and Cleveland Guardians pitcher Gavin Williams, one place just isn’t enough.

Williams and Guardians’ teammate Hunter Gaddis were recently in New York to face the Yankees. The two went on a tour of the city to try three of the hot spots known for their pizza. In the Guardians’ social media episode of “XXL Bites,” Williams and his teammate give their take on the slices at Ray’s Pizza, $1.50 Fresh Pizza and Sacco Pizza.

Watch the video to see which one Williams and Gaddis liked the best. Hint: It’s the one Barstool Sports’ Dave Portnoy recently gave a thumbs-up.
